Where can I find a mord cartificate for Elizabeth Radford nee Poulton married Edward Radford last known address in Thorpe, norwich. Can anyone give me some advice?

Guinevere

Guinevere Report 25 Jan 2004 08:16

Hi, If it was after July 1837 then iboth will probably be on the GRO index of Births, marriages and deaths. It's just a question of trawling through the fiche at a record office or LDS centre to find the reference to send for the cert. Some events are on FreeBMD and all events should be on 1837online which is a pay to view site. Click on the resources button on the left of the screen for more information. Gwynne
